The video tutorial explains how to determine if two figures are congruent using sequences of transformations. It covers rigid transformations, including rotations, reflections, and translations, which preserve size and shape. The tutorial demonstrates congruence between figures D and B, and figures F and A, using various transformation sequences. It emphasizes that multiple sequences can achieve the same result, encouraging viewers to explore different methods.
